The Home Depot Vice President of Talent Management Salaries in New York

The average The Home Depot Vice President of Talent Management in New York earns an estimated $169,421 annually. The Home Depot's Vice President of Talent Management compensation is $55,011 less than the US average for a Vice President of Talent Management.

In New York, The HR Department at The Home Depot earns $2,078 more on average than the Operations Department.

Vice President of Talent Management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female Vice President of Talent Management at companies similar size to The Home Depot reported making $278,742, while the average male Vice President of Talent Management at similar sized companies reported making $252,263.

Vice President of Talent Management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Asian or Pacific Islander Vice President of Talent Management at companies similar size to The Home Depot reported making $327,333, while the average Hispanic or Latino Vice President of Talent Management at similar sized companies reported making $111,000.

How Vice Presidents of Talent Management at The Home Depot Rate Their Compensation

The majority of Vice Presidents of Talent Management at The Home Depot believe they're compensated fairly. 78% of Vice Presidents of Talent Management at The Home Depot say they receive annual bonuses, and the vast majority (73%) are satisfied with their benefits.
